The Aardvarc Approach

At Aardvarc, we’re driven by a love of nature and an appreciation for practical and personal design. Whether applied to residential, multi-residential, commercial or retail projects, we approach design using novel ideas, and both new and used materials, in order to produce environmentally conscious and meaningful architecture.  We respect our Clients’ most valuable resources – time and money, and seek to preserve these finite commodities.  Instead of design for design’s sake, we believe that the best design is shaped through collaboration between everyone involved, all working towards a common goal.

RAIA 2007 2007 RAIA Central Queensland Regional Building of the Year and Sustainability Award winner.

“It has a beautifully judged elegance achieved without any ostentation. The subtle greens of the lightweight cladding tone with the translucent panels recede into the shadows of the gnarled Bloodwoods, Xanthorrhoea and Livingstonias, leaving only the tracery of the fine timber battened construction on show. The stepping longitudinal section of this project is masterful in directing view, inducing ventilation and choreographing lifestyle. Handrails, roof pitches, floor levels and framing details have a rightness that can only come from a love of nature, a mastery of construction methods and an absolute commitment to architectural quality.”
RAIA Judge 2007 Peter Skinner Head of Architecture, University of Qld
